Gilmore is a transitioning neighbourhood in northwest Richmond, BC, known historically for its light industrial uses but increasingly featuring new residential developments as the area evolves. Located near No. 3 Road and Bridgeport Road, Gilmore is convenient to Richmond City Centre, the Bridgeport Canada Line station, and quick connections to Vancouver via Highway 99 and Oak Street. New townhouse and low-rise condo developments are attracting young professionals and investors drawn by the area's transit access and lower price points relative to central Richmond. As Richmond continues its residential intensification strategy, Gilmore represents an emerging opportunity in the city's real estate landscape.
